What is redland-utils
redland-utils is:
This package provides the rdfproc utility for processing the Resource Description Framework (RDF) format using the Redland RDF library. It allows reading RDF from syntaxes, manipulating the RDF graph, querying using RDQL and SPARQL and serializing RDF into syntaxes in RDF/XML, N-Triples, Turtle and RSS 1.0.
There are three methods to install redland-utils on Kali Linux. We can use apt-get, apt and aptitude. In the following sections we will describe each method. You can choose one of them.
Install redland-utils Using apt-get
Update apt database with apt-get using the following command.
sudo apt-get updateAfter updating apt database, We can install redland-utils using apt-get by running the following command:
sudo apt-get -y install redland-utilsInstall redland-utils Using apt
Update apt database with apt using the following command.
sudo apt updateAfter updating apt database, We can install redland-utils using apt by running the following command:
sudo apt -y install redland-utilsInstall redland-utils Using aptitude
